Understanding the Building Contract Agreement



What is a Building Contract Agreement?



A building contract agreement is a legally binding document that outlines the terms and conditions between a client (or owner) and a contractor for the construction or renovation of a building or structure. It serves as a roadmap for the project, detailing responsibilities, expectations, costs, timelines, and other critical aspects.

By referencing a building contract agreement sample, both parties can ensure they are aligned on all relevant points before work commences, reducing the likelihood of disputes and providing clarity if disagreements arise.

Why Is a Building Contract Agreement Important?



- Legal Protection: It offers legal assurance and recourse if either party breaches the terms.
- Clear Expectations: It defines scope, responsibilities, and deliverables, minimizing misunderstandings.
- Financial Clarity: Establishes payment schedules, costs, and change management procedures.
- Timeline Management: Sets deadlines and milestones, aiding project scheduling.
- Dispute Resolution: Includes procedures for resolving conflicts amicably or legally.

Key Components of a Building Contract Agreement Sample



A comprehensive building contract agreement sample should include the following sections:

1. Parties’ Details


- Full legal names of the client and contractor.
- Contact information, including addresses, phone numbers, and email addresses.
- Legal status (individual, company, partnership).

2. Scope of Work


- Detailed description of the project.
- Specific tasks to be performed.
- Plans, drawings, or specifications attached as appendices.
- Any exclusions or limitations.

3. Contract Price and Payment Terms


- Total project cost or method of calculation.
- Payment schedule (e.g., deposit, progress payments, final payment).
- Payment methods accepted.
- Conditions for withholding payments (e.g., completion milestones).

4. Timeline and Deadlines


- Commencement date.
- Estimated completion date.
- Milestones or phases.
- Penalties for delays.

5. Variations and Change Orders


- Procedure for requesting changes.
- Cost adjustments for variations.
- Approval process.

6. Responsibilities and Warranties


- Contractor’s obligations (quality, safety, licensing).
- Client’s responsibilities (access, approvals).
- Warranties on workmanship and materials.

7. Insurance and Bonds


- Types of insurance coverage required.
- Proof of insurance.
- Performance bonds if applicable.

8. Dispute Resolution


- Mediation, arbitration, or court proceedings.
- Jurisdiction and governing law.

9. Termination Clause


- Conditions under which either party may terminate.
- Notice requirements.
- Settlement of outstanding payments upon termination.

10. Miscellaneous Clauses


- Confidentiality.
- Indemnity.
- Force majeure.
- Assignment clauses.

Sample Building Contract Agreement Template



Below is a simplified sample outline of a building contract agreement. Remember, it is advisable to consult legal professionals to tailor the document to your jurisdiction and specific project needs.


BUILDING CONTRACT AGREEMENT

This Building Contract (“Agreement”) is made on this ____ day of ____________, 20__, between:

Client: [Full Name], residing at [Address], contact: [Phone/Email]

Contractor: [Company Name or Full Name], registered at [Address], contact: [Phone/Email]

1. Scope of Work
The Contractor agrees to perform the following work: [Detailed description, attached plans/specifications].

2. Contract Price
The total amount payable for the work is $__________, payable as follows:
- Deposit: $__________ upon signing.
- Progress payments: $__________ at each milestone.
- Final payment: $__________ upon completion.

3. Timeline
Work shall commence on ____________ and be completed no later than ____________.

4. Variations
Any changes to the scope will be documented via written change orders and may affect the contract price and timeline.

5. Responsibilities
- The Contractor shall perform work in accordance with industry standards and applicable laws.
- The Client shall provide access and necessary approvals.

6. Insurance and Bonds
The Contractor shall maintain appropriate insurance coverage and provide proof upon request.

7. Dispute Resolution
Any disputes arising from this Agreement shall be settled through mediation or arbitration in [Jurisdiction].

8. Termination
Either party may terminate this Agreement with written notice if terms are breached.

9. Signatures
_____________________________ _____________________________
Client’s Signature & Date Contractor’s Signature & Date


Tips for Customizing a Building Contract Agreement Sample



- Use Clear Language: Avoid ambiguous terms; clarity minimizes misunderstandings.
- Include Attachments: Attach detailed plans, specifications, and payment schedules.
- Legal Review: Have the contract reviewed by a legal professional familiar with local construction laws.
- Specificity: Be specific about deliverables, timelines, and responsibilities.
- Flexibility: Incorporate provisions for unforeseen circumstances, such as delays or additional work.

Can a building contract agreement sample be used for international construction projects?

While the basic structure can be similar, international projects often require specific clauses related to jurisdiction, currency, import/export regulations, and language considerations, so it's advisable to adapt the sample accordingly and seek legal advice.
